**Q: What do I do if the Frameforge transcoding farm loses its scheduler quorum?**

Happens more than we'd like. First, drain the worker pool so half-finished jobs don't pile up. Then restart the scheduler nodes one at a time — never all at once, or you'll get split-brain and a very bad afternoon. If the control plane still won't unseal after that, you'll need the recovery passphrase to reinitialize it. For convenience, here it is:

unlock words, hahip-baduf: holwyn-istath-julvan

Team,

Warranty costs on the Ardelix 400 line are 38% over forecast for the quarter. Root cause: a hinge supplier change made in spring; failures cluster in units shipped from the Brennock plant. Immediate actions: supplier reverted, extended-warranty pricing frozen, claims triage doubled. Finance projects the overrun will dent margin through year-end. For our incoming director — this lands in your lap Monday; briefing deck is being prepared. Strategic implications for the product line are summarized in the note below.

internal memo for faweg-tafog: Only 7 of the 100 pilot accounts renewed Quenael, so a churn review is set for April 15.

Handover: SpoolHawk printer-spooler microservice. For new folks joining Team Inkline: SpoolHawk queues render jobs from the Docket gateway and retries failed dispatches three times with exponential backoff. Watch the dead-letter queue after any deploy — stuck jobs usually mean the renderer pool at the Marlow datacenter is saturated. Config lives in the spoolhawk-ops repo; never edit the retry limits in production directly. Runbooks cover the common failure modes in detail. The on-call escalation path ends with the service owner, named below.

account owner for kagef-kahag: Norwyn Quenmir Ulaax